As for the emailing thing it is most likely an email sending issue more than a code problem. For example spam filters incorrectly grabiing those emails or something of that nature..
Best thing to do is try different things for emailing options until you get something that works. I suggest using CDOSYS with a real email server and using a valid email account for yourself at that email domain. SMTP authentication if necessary. This will ensure the emails sent have valid MX records and dont get treated as spam.

, Turn off "Show Friendly HTTP error messages"
If you are getting errors with your ASP application go to Internet Explorer and make sure this setting is unchecked. Having this checked can cause a generic error to be displayed in you web browser when ASP code encounters an error. This generic error message doesn't really help you fix the problem. Having this setting unchecked will usually result in a more detailed error message and the line number the error is occurring at, thus giving you a good clue as to where the problem is within the ASP code. If detailed ASP error messages have been disabled at the server level this setting will make no difference.

While there is no option in the admin area / asp code we give you here is what I can tell you.
You have the source code and we also use an open database structure. (MSAccess or MSSQL) So that means you can really run any query you want on the database whether with ASP code or directly in your database. You can even tie other systems and code into the database via OBDC and manipulate data. The sky is the limit.
In MSSQL you can run queries in SQL enterprise manager or query analyzer. Using Access you can run queries in query view.
It's really not that hard if you do some research on SQL Statements and how to use them. You can do some very powerful queries and save yourself a lot of time. , Seems as though changing the mail settings to "remote email server" did the trick.

vaghelis38300.5280208333, More info on the groups session variable.
Session("Groups") will contain the ID numbers of whatever groups the user is a part of.
It does not store the descriptive name of that group. It will show the same data that is actually stored in the "Groups" field in the database.
for example it might hold a value like this
*2*,*5*,*9*
meaning a user is part of groups 2, 5, and 9
so if you wanted to check to see if a user was part of a particular group you would do something like this
<%
If InStr(Session("Groups"),"*9*") Then
Response.Write("You are a member of group 9")
End If
%>
Taking this even further, if you really wanted to get a particular group's name or description you would have to query the database like so. In this case we ask it the name and description for group 9.
Group_ID=9
Set ConnPasswords =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Connection")
ConnPasswords.Open ConnectionString
Set cmdTemp =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Command")
Set CmdEditGroup =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Recordset")
cmdTemp.CommandText = "SELECT " & tbl_label_groups & ".* FROM " & tbl_label_groups & " WHERE (Group_ID = " & Group_ID & ")"
cmdTemp.CommandType = 1
Set cmdTemp.ActiveConnection = ConnPasswords
CmdEditGroup.Open cmdTemp, , 0, 1
Group_Name = CmdEditGroup("Group_Name")
Group_Desc = CmdEditGroup("Group_Desc")
